Output 8d62d248af63719aa1d19dd0877d01287e35ffa95e58ea1f0f024ae19d965e74:0

value
815993130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59507fb858f782ed4d04ad563493bccd4f49f0c2 OP_EQUAL
address
39qGVn7yPAGgu5G5444K5ZPtv6NT4J9vgs
transaction
8d62d248af63719aa1d19dd0877d01287e35ffa95e58ea1f0f024ae19d965e74
confirmations
275668
spent
true